Reference excerpt

Palmoplantar ectodermal dysplasia is a cutaneous condition. Types include:

Palmoplantar ectodermal dysplasia type 1 or Pachyonychia congenita type I Palmoplantar ectodermal dysplasia type 3 or Acrokeratoelastoidosis Palmoplantar ectodermal dysplasia type 4 or Papillon–Lefèvre syndrome Palmoplantar ectodermal dysplasia type 5 or Tyrosinemia type II Palmoplantar ectodermal dysplasia type 6 or Olmsted syndrome Palmoplantar ectodermal dysplasia type 8 or Meleda disease

See also Ectodermal dysplasia
